What Is Holistic-Complementary Medicine? Complimentary and conventional medicine adopt very different approaches toward the definition and treatment of disease. Conventional medicine is diagnosis-led: doctors use symptoms and medical tests to assess the problem, and prescribe treatment accordingly. Complimentary (holistic) practitioners aim to deal with the patient as a whole (holistic) person: for them, illness signifies a disruption of physical and mental well-being. Treatment attempts to stimulate the body's natural self-healing and self-regulating abilities.
These webpages look at the "holistic" approach to health - the central tenet of which is that mind and body are inextricably linked. It also assesses scientific investigations into the effect of the mind on the body. As complimentary medicine grows in popularity, issues of efficacy and safety become increasingly important. Given the valuable contributions of both traditions as a whole promises to be an integration of the best aspects of conventional medicine and complimentary therapies.

A Guide To Well-Being
Well-being occurs when the mind and body work in harmony: energy and enthusiasm are abundant, the body functions efficiently, the mind is alert, and there is a feeling of being emotionally supported by family and friends, of being able to deal with most of life's challenges. But good health can never be taken for granted: stress, age, responsibilities, poor diet, and a sedentary way of life will almost inevitably have an adverse effect.
Definite symptoms - pain, indigestion, fever - may prompt us to seek medical advice, but often there is simply a nagging sense of feeling not quite right. Complimentary practitioners emphasize that optimum health is dependent on the interaction of a number of factors, including lifestyle, environment, relationships, and ability to cope. They believe that by learning to understand and recognize what makes us susceptible or resilient, we can make lifestyle adjustments that will restore and enhance well-being.
